KERA-TV
Dallas, Texas
1st (known) logo
(1987-2000)
Logo: On a orange textured background that scrolls upward, the letters "KERA" (also in blue, with downward-scrolling textures) zoom out from the left to the center of the screen, and fade to orange. The background fades to blue, then white. Below this, "Dallas Fort Worth Denton" appears, and that fades to "PRESENTS" (both of which are in a yellow Times font).
FX: The background changing colors, "KERA" zooming out, and the text changing.
Music: A few synth drum beats, followed by a synthesized six-note tune, and then a synth keyboard flourish.
Availability: Rare, unless PBS still airs KERA-TV programs of this era, which are mainly imported kids' shows from Canada and the UK. I know "Tots TV", "Groundling Marsh", and "Katie & Orbie" had this logo at the end of their shows (odd, isn't it, considering the "Dallas Fort Worth Denton" fading into "Presents" is part of the logo's animation).
Scare Factor: Low; this is probably a favorite among CLG fans.
